- Brief Summary
To investigate how pulse wave velocity, aortic augmentation index and the arterial pulse wave given by the Arteriograph contributes to preoperative assesment, intraoperative and intensive care monitoring.

- Arm && Interventions
Group Intervention Description Preoperative Arteriograph A single measurement with an Arteriograph is performed a day before an elective surgical intervention. Intraoperative Arteriograph An arteriograph is put on the patient for the time of operation. The device is set to measure in every 5 minutes. Intensive Care Unit Arteriograph Three separate measurements are performed on the subject with an Arteriograph throughout every dayshift for 3 days.
- Primary Outcome Measures
Name Time Method Correlation between systemic vascular resistance and aortic augmentation index One year Identity of cardiac output given by the PiCCO monitor and cardiac output given by the Arteriograph One year Number and degree of hypotensive episodes predicted by preoperative values of pulse wave velocity. One year The investigators will examine if high values of pulse wave velocity correlate with the frequency and severity of hypotensive episodes under anaesthesia.
